VPS侦探论坛

 找回密码
 注册
查看: 237|回复: 3

空间上的图片文件夹全部删除,不存在图片如何显示指定

[复制链接]
发表于 2019-8-10 10:18:30 | 显示全部楼层 |阅读模式



空间上的图片文件夹全部删除,不存在图片如何显示指定某个图片,环境是lnmpa,htaccess怎么设置?或者怎么设置

美国VPS推荐: 遨游主机LinodeLOCVPSKVMLAVPS2EZ搬瓦工80VPSVultr美国VPS主机中国VPS推荐: 阿里云腾讯云。LNMP付费服务(代装/问题排查)QQ 503228080
发表于 2019-8-10 15:15:19 | 显示全部楼层



lnmpa是nginx处理静态文件,在apache上或者.htaccess 上设置肯定是不起作用的
需要在nginx上设置
如果图片在某个特定目录的话可以这样试试

  1. location /images {
  2.         location ~ ^/images/([_-a-zA-Z0-9]*) {
  3.                 error_page 404 /images/default.jpg;
  4.         }
  5. }
复制代码
Linux下Nginx+MySQL+PHP自动安装工具:https://lnmp.org/
 楼主| 发表于 2019-8-10 15:52:22 | 显示全部楼层



licess 发表于 2019-8-10 15:15
lnmpa是nginx处理静态文件,在apache上或者.htaccess 上设置肯定是不起作用的
需要在nginx上设置
如果图片 ...

谢谢军歌回复,我的图片是在/Uploads/image这个目录下面,我的代码这样写没有效果,是哪里错了吗
  1.                 location /images {
  2.                                 location ~ ^/Uploads/image/([_-a-zA-Z0-9]*) {
  3.                                                 error_page 404 /Public/images/asklogo.jpg;
  4.                                 }
  5.                 }
复制代码

美国VPS、VPN、域名代购:http://shop63846532.taobao.com/

发表于 2019-8-11 10:10:44 | 显示全部楼层



caiheqing 发表于 2019-8-10 15:52
谢谢军歌回复,我的图片是在/Uploads/image这个目录下面,我的代码这样写没有效果,是哪里错了吗
...

前面都给你写好例子了,目录都写不对肯定不生效
目录和默认图片都是相对目录
Linux下Nginx+MySQL+PHP自动安装工具:https://lnmp.org/
您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|VPS侦探 ( 鲁ICP备16040043号-1 )

GMT+8, 2019-9-20 10:20 , Processed in 0.044800 second(s), 27 queries .

Powered by Discuz! X3.4

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表